当前位置: 首页 > news >正文

FullBypass最佳实践:安全研究人员和渗透测试者的10个使用建议

FullBypass最佳实践:安全研究人员和渗透测试者的10个使用建议

【免费下载链接】FullBypassA tool which bypasses AMSI (AntiMalware Scan Interface) and PowerShell CLM (Constrained Language Mode) and gives you a FullLanguage PowerShell reverse shell.项目地址: https://gitcode.com/gh_mirrors/fu/FullBypass

FullBypass是一款强大的安全工具,专门用于绕过Windows系统的AMSI(反恶意软件扫描接口)和PowerShell CLM(受限语言模式),为安全研究人员和渗透测试者提供完整的PowerShell反向shell功能。这款工具在合法的安全评估和红队演练中发挥着重要作用,帮助专业人员测试系统防御能力。

🔍 FullBypass核心功能解析

1. AMSI绕过机制详解

FullBypass采用内存劫持技术,通过修改AmsiScanBuffer函数的指令来绕过AMSI检测。这种方法能够将大小参数设置为0,使AMSI无法检测后续的PowerShell脚本和命令。

2. PowerShell CLM突破技术

工具不仅绕过AMSI,还能突破PowerShell的受限语言模式,为用户提供完整的FullLanguage PowerShell环境。这意味着您可以执行所有PowerShell功能,包括通常受限制的模块和命令。

🛠️ FullBypass安装与配置指南

快速部署步骤

  1. 下载项目文件:从仓库下载FullBypass.csproj文件
  2. 选择可写目录:将文件放置在可写文件夹中,如C:\Windows\Tasks或C:\Windows\Temp
  3. 执行编译命令:使用msbuild.exe执行项目文件
C:\Windows\Microsoft.NET\Framework64\v4.0.30319\msbuild.exe .\FullBypass.csproj

环境要求检查

  • Windows操作系统
  • .NET Framework 4.0或更高版本
  • PowerShell进程正在运行

📊 使用场景与最佳实践

合法渗透测试应用

FullBypass主要应用于:

  • 红队演练:测试组织安全防御能力
  • 安全评估:验证AMSI防护效果
  • 研究学习:理解Windows安全机制

5个关键使用技巧

  1. 多进程处理:工具会自动检测所有运行的PowerShell进程,并尝试对每个进程进行AMSI绕过
  2. 内存保护修改:通过VirtualProtectEx函数修改内存保护属性,确保写入操作成功
  3. 精确函数定位:搜索amsi.dll中的AmsiScanBuffer函数,确保准确修改
  4. 反向shell配置:成功绕过后,工具会提示输入攻击者IP和端口,建立连接
  5. 错误处理机制:包含完善的错误检测和用户提示

⚠️ 安全与合规注意事项

伦理使用准则

  • 仅限授权测试:仅在拥有明确授权的环境中使用
  • 遵守法律法规:遵循所有相关法律和行业规定
  • 教育培训目的:可用于安全教育培训和研究学习

风险控制措施

  1. 环境隔离:在隔离的测试环境中使用
  2. 权限管理:确保使用适当的权限级别
  3. 日志记录:记录所有测试活动
  4. 清理工作:测试完成后清理所有痕迹

🔧 高级配置选项

自定义修改建议

您可以根据需要修改Program.cs文件中的以下部分:

  • 反向shell命令:第161-181行的PowerShell脚本
  • 内存操作参数:第128行的劫持字节数组
  • 进程选择逻辑:第35-45行的进程检测代码

性能优化技巧

  • 选择最近的PowerShell进程进行操作
  • 确保有足够的系统权限
  • 在低负载时段执行操作

🎯 常见问题解决

问题1:无法找到PowerShell进程

解决方案:确保至少有一个PowerShell进程正在运行,或者手动启动PowerShell。

问题2:AMSI绕过失败

解决方案:检查系统权限,确保以管理员身份运行,或尝试不同的可写目录。

问题3:反向shell连接失败

解决方案:验证网络配置,确保防火墙允许连接,检查IP和端口设置。

📈 工具优势分析

技术优势

  • 双重绕过:同时绕过AMSI和PowerShell CLM
  • 稳定性高:采用成熟的API调用方式
  • 兼容性好:支持多种Windows版本

操作优势

  • 使用简单:单命令执行
  • 反馈明确:详细的控制台输出
  • 自动化程度高:自动检测和配置

🚀 未来发展方向

功能增强建议

  1. 图形界面:开发可视化操作界面
  2. 更多绕过技术:集成其他AMSI绕过方法
  3. 跨平台支持:扩展支持Linux和macOS
  4. 模块化设计:允许用户选择不同的绕过模块

社区贡献

欢迎安全研究人员贡献代码和改进建议,共同完善这个有用的安全工具。

💡 总结与建议

FullBypass作为一款专业的AMSI和PowerShell CLM绕过工具,为安全研究人员提供了强大的测试能力。正确使用该工具可以帮助组织更好地理解Windows安全机制的弱点,从而制定更有效的防御策略。

记住:能力越大,责任越大。始终在合法、授权的环境中使用安全工具,为构建更安全的数字世界贡献力量。

提示:定期检查项目更新,关注最新的安全研究和绕过技术发展。

【免费下载链接】FullBypassA tool which bypasses AMSI (AntiMalware Scan Interface) and PowerShell CLM (Constrained Language Mode) and gives you a FullLanguage PowerShell reverse shell.项目地址: https://gitcode.com/gh_mirrors/fu/FullBypass

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/1003593/

相关文章:

  • 宁德市2026年最新 - 大熊猫898989
  • 5步搭建Windows RTMP服务器:快速搭建流媒体服务的终极指南
  • 汕头市2026年最新 - 大熊猫898989
  • 开源AI代理生产系统:五层架构与全链路落地实践
  • 语音+大语言模型:从语音交互到协同思考的技术跃迁
  • 聊聊土耳其移民办理费用,价格多少钱 - mypinpai
  • Unity强化学习实操包:Anaconda配环境+RollBall训练全流程(含可直接运行的工程文件)
  • Metabase企业级性能优化架构:构建高并发数据平台的最佳实践
  • 攀枝花市2026年最新 - 大熊猫898989
  • 汕尾市2026年最新 - 大熊猫898989
  • nativeShare.js快速上手:3分钟集成微信朋友圈与QQ空间分享功能
  • Claude 4架构级精简:相对位置编码层归零原理与工程实践
  • 2026年 钢丝网骨架PE复合管厂家:市政/消防/农田灌溉高压输水与抗压防爆全场景优选 - 品牌发掘
  • FullBypass防御对策:如何快速检测和防止AMSI内存劫持攻击
  • Label Studio ML Backend:构建AI辅助标注系统的技术架构与实践
  • 别再踩坑了!Unity 2022.3 WebGL与Vue通信的3个关键配置和5个常见错误排查
  • 2026年分光光度计市场格局:主流品牌与产品深度解析 - 优质品牌商家
  • STM32的GPIO模拟‘类I2C’驱动Aip1629A踩坑实录:时序、电平与代码优化
  • ALB项目法律与道德考量:游戏作弊的边界与风险分析
  • 平顶山市2026年最新 - 大熊猫898989
  • 2026年超声波清洗机哪家口碑好,专业推荐靠谱品牌与性价比分析 - myqiye
  • 2026年网线延长器芯片选型指南:市场趋势与适配方案解析市场背景:网线延长器芯片需求升级
  • 高并发架构终极总结
  • 保定余生黄金回收等六大品牌2026年6月测评 - 余生黄金回收
  • Apache Derby 本地数据库环境:嵌入式+网络服务双模式,带多语言错误提示与常用工具脚本
  • 告别大电解电容!用MC14521B芯片DIY一个高精度长延时定时器(附完整电路图)
  • 智慧职教刷课脚本:3分钟告别手动学习烦恼的终极解决方案
  • 纯Matplotlib实现高性能交互式图表的工程实践
  • Keil5 + STLink调试STM32,这几个隐藏的效率和避坑点你可能不知道
  • 揭秘家具维修翻新培训学校靠谱吗,怎么选购 - myqiye